Quick Summary

The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(USACE) Portland District intends to solicit construction firms for Cottonwood Pile Dike Repairs on the Lower Columbia River in Cowlitz County, Washington. This is a Presolicitation for a Total Small Business Set-Aside project, with an estimated value between $10,000,000.00 and $25,000,000.00. The solicitation is tentatively scheduled for release on or about March 20, 2026, with proposals due around April 21, 2026.

Scope of Work

The project focuses on focused, cost-effective repairs to select sections of individual pile dikes between River Mile 68 and River Mile 72 that have experienced significant loss of visible piles, severely compromising their hydraulic function. Key requirements include:

  • Enrockment repair/enhancement at ten pile dikes.
  • Shore connection with an offset pile dike at five of the pile dikes to address shoreline erosion.
  • Removal of debris within rock placement areas that would interfere with stone placement, with disposal at an approved upland facility. Debris removal requirements will be based on pre-construction high-resolution multi-beam bathymetric survey data.
